In newly released footage quickly gaining widespread attention, China has showcased a remarkably realistic bird-like drone, which appears to be designed mainly for reconnaissance missions. The video features members of the People’s Liberation Army (PLA) “Sea Dragon” commandos operating this innovative device. This drone is designed to closely mimic the appearance and movement of a real bird, with its wing-flapping capability enhancing its disguise. The primary goal of this design is to enable the drone to blend seamlessly into its surroundings, thereby remaining undetected by enemy forces and providing a tactical advantage in covert operations.

While specific technical details about this particular drone remain undisclosed, it is known that nature-inspired unmanned aerial systems (UASs), such as ornithopters, have a range of potential applications. These devices can carry various payloads, including sensors and small cameras, which can be used for intelligence collection missions. Additionally, they can be equipped with micro-warheads, potentially allowing for kamikaze-style attacks. This advanced technology offers China a significant strategic advantage by enabling covert operations that are difficult for adversaries to detect.

The released videos feature soldiers from the PLA’s Jiaolong (“Sea Dragon”) Commando Forces, a unit comparable to the U.S. Navy SEALs. One video depicts a soldier launching a medium-sized bird drone, approximately the size of a pigeon, while another video shows a soldier operating a larger drone, roughly the size of a hawk. According to Interesting Engineering, the concept of bird-like drones is not novel for China. Earlier models resembling birds were introduced in 2018, and in 2022, Chinese engineers revealed a large mechanical flying bird weighing 1.6 kilograms and featuring a wingspan of two meters. This larger drone is reported to have a flight duration of up to one and a half hours, powered by a lithium battery.
